The Madison County Executive Leadership class kicked off their program year with Government Day on Wednesday, February 26. The 2025 class toured the Mississippi State Capitol, met with the Madison County legislative delegation, toured the Mississippi Supreme Court, received updates on County road projects from Central District Transportation Commissioner Willie Simmons and MDOT Executive Director Brad White, and engaged with statewide elected officials. It was an incredible opportunity to gain insight into how the government operates and to stay informed about what’s happening in Madison County. The MCEL program is sponsored by the Madison County Economic Development Authority (MCEDA) and the Madison County Business League & Foundation.
